Well, about 2 weeks ago I got my plane tickets home for Christmas break.  It's the only time I go home each year and it usually turns out to be the best couple of weeks I have each year.  There has been one constant every year I've lived out here that will not exist in all likelyhood this year: hockey.

Each year since I have lived in LA, the Caps have had a home game a few days before Christmas.  Each year I get tickets for myself and 3 of my closest friends from college.  With the exception of the first year I went home (before I was on these boards) I go to F-Street before each game and say hi to the webbies.  Then watch the game (the Caps have won every time I've gone) then go to Fados afterward before heading home.  It is usually a night I talk about for months afterward, but it won't exist this year.  Had the season gone as planned I would have had a two-fer...  Caps vs. Blues on Dec 22, then Jan 1st they played at home, then the next day on my birthday I have a ticket for the Redskins. 

Now I have to come up with something new to do.  It doesn't sound like a huge deal, and really in the grand scheme of things it isn't, but damn if that night isn't special to me.  Life is about creating memories and I have so many memories from those 4 nights.  I'm sure I'll find something else we can all do, but it's not the same without hockey.
